Charlie “Rocket” Jabaley is the former manager of 2 Chainz and founding partner at Street Execs. He lost 135 pounds, ran 3 marathons, reversed the growth of a brain tumor, became an Ironman and accomplished his dream of becoming a Nike athlete. In this episode, listen to Charlie speak on the power your ideas have and choosing self-love and positive frequencies in life.

Miguel Aguilar is the CEO of a training facility known as Self Made. Miguel strives to make people believe they can become the best version of yourself. From homeless at 16, living in his car, being addicted to drugs & alcohol, to the owner of a unique personal training facility. In this episode, Miguel shows what it means to lead by example and overcome your demons.
